If digital distribution (whether on 360, PS3, or Wii) followed the same route as retail games, one could pick up Castle Crashers for about $5 by now. I most definitely would, even if I still wouldn't be able to sell it on should I feel like it.
In the end, it really comes down to pricing. If a game costs $15 or $60 then that's perfectly fine. If, half a year later, the $15 game is still $15 and the $60 game is $20 (with the added bonus of having resale value), it does tend to raise a few eyebrows, no matter how good the game in question would be.
